For us, circus performance has always been about more than tricks.
James brings the comedy chaos, audience interaction and high-energy juggling side of the show. Kylie brings visually striking circus performance including aerials, Cyr wheel and lollipop lyra acts. Together, we try to create performances that feel both impressive and genuinely human.

Every event is different.
Corporate events require a different energy to festivals. Shopping centres need performers who can naturally engage passing crowds without overwhelming the environment. Family audiences respond differently to gala dinner guests. Great circus performers understand how to shift their performance style depending on the audience and atmosphere.
That flexibility matters far more than people realise.
